Everything seemed ok but I checked the super notes on the podPress wiki. Fantastic help in there, especially for a noob (or should I say knob lol) like me. It turns out that the enabling the stats feature can cause some feeds to break on some servers. I guess mine is one of them. Not really important as I can use Libsyn’s stats anyway. So I turned it off and hey presto feed is back working.
